Long Wall Company was created in 2025 to accelerate missile defense technology for the U.S. and our allies. Building on the RS1 and GS0 launch systems, Long Wall develops containerized, mass‑producible missile defense systems and offers rapid, low‑cost flight testing. We believe that the future of global security and stability requires defensive technology that is lower cost, higher performing, better tested, and more broadly distributed than is possible today.

Description

As a Sr. Electronics Design Engineer, you will lead the design, development, build, testing and commissioning of electrical systems for missile defense technologies at Long Wall. You will have the opportunity to be a key member of a small team of mechanical, fluid, and electrical engineers working to develop innovative deployable missile defense solutions. This individual will be responsible for electrical design, test and integration, from concept to production, while ensuring alignment with strategic business goals.

This is a responsible engineer role that contributes to every mission and every flight we fly as we continue to reimagine the future of missile defense systems.

Responsibilities
  • Rapidly design, develop and test highly reliable electronics for communicating with our Platforms.
  • Drive electrical architecture, specification, component selection, schematic capture, circuit board layout design, implementation, low‑level firmware development, verification, board bring‑up and debugging.
  • Partner with software, mechanical, thermal, manufacturing teams and production test teams.
  • Derive engineering justification to resolve production issues throughout assembly, test, and vehicle integration.
Basic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ering or similar field AND 8 years of relevant experience.
  • Master’s degree AND 6 years of experience.
  • PhD AND 3 years of experience.
  • Relevant

    Experience:

    working in space, aerospace, or equivalent professional environments with direct hands‑on experience developing complex electrical power conversion systems.
Preferred Skills And Experience
  • Min. 5+ years of professional experience rapidly designing and delivering highly reliable products.
  • Min. 5+ years of electronic product experience designing hardware from concept through production; strong emphasis on full life cycle development of new hardware products and not small incremental updates to legacy hardware.
  • Min. 5+ years of experience designing and implementing mixed‑signal circuit host boards from concept through production using processors, FPGAs, SoCs, SoMs. Experience implementing Ethernet, multi‑GHz Ser Des, DRAM interfaces (DDR4), PCIe, I2C, SPI, operational amplifiers, analog to digital and digital to analog converters, and power supply components.
  • Min. 5+ years of professional experience testing, troubleshooting and debugging electronics.
  • Experience working in military or aerospace industries with a strong background in MIL‑STD‑461, 464, 810, DO‑160 compliance, or similar industrial/automotive standards.
  • Strong understanding of computers and programming languages (Python, C/C++).
  • Demonstrated ability to work in a highly cross‑functional role.
  • Self‑starter with demonstrated experience on multiple projects making hardware work within demanding time and resource constraints.
  • Excellent communication skills both written and verbal.
